Overview of Gene Research
Fam229a, a gene with its specific function yet to be fully characterized in a general context, may be involved in biological processes related to cancer growth and metastasis. However, its associated pathways and core biological importance are still being explored, and genetic models can be crucial for further understanding its function.
In a study on prostate cancer, DU145-KO cell line, constructed by transfecting DU145 cells with a genome-wide knock-out library, was used in in vivo experiments. When transplanted into immunocompromised Nu/Nu mice, analysis of sequence data from primary tumors and micro-metastasis sites showed that the abundance of sgRNAs significantly changed. Fam229a was among fifteen target genes selected for experimental validation. Knock-out of Fam229a led to the enhanced potential of invasion and metastasis of DU145 cells [1].
In conclusion, through gene knockout-based research, Fam229a has been shown to play a role in suppressing the invasion and metastasis potential of prostate cancer cells in the DU145 cell line model. These findings contribute to understanding the molecular mechanisms of prostate cancer metastasis and may provide potential targets for prostate cancer therapy [1].
